Five Bodies and Eight Vargnas

A liberated soul does not have a material
body, mind, speech, and does not breathe. The soul is totally free from
all karmas. It merely exists in Moksha in the permanent blissful state.
As far as a worldly soul is concerned it
possesses a material body along with some other types of bodies. These
bodies are made up from different types of varganas (matters). Jainism
explains that eight types of vargana exist in the universe. Every space in
the universe is filled with these vargana. When five of the eight vargana
when attach to the worldly soul they create five different bodies. The
remaining three vargana provide three different functions to the material
body.
The eight Vargnas (matters) are:
- Audaric vargana - creates the physical
body of the living being
- Tejas vargana - creates the Tejas body
to the living being which provides heat and digestion power to the
audaric body.
- Karman vargana - creates Karmic or
Causal body
- Aharac vargana - creates Aharac body,
which is very small in size and is possessed by some unique soul
- Vaikriya vargana - creates Vaikriya
body, which can be converted into very small or large in size
- Breathing vargana- provides breathing
- Mind vargana - provides mind for
thinking
- Speech vargana - provides speech
The five bodies are:
- Audaric body -The body that we see
from the outside (Bahya Sthula Sharira) is called Audaric body. It is
made up of Audaric vargna. A person can not be liberated without the
help of this body. Hence it is the most important body of the human
being. At the time of death, the soul leaves this body behind.
- Tejas body - This body is made up of
Tejas vargna. This body is responsible for digestion, heat, etc. in the
Audaric body. At the time of death, it accompanies the soul and helps to
create a new Audaric body for the soul.
- Karmic/Causal Body (Karmana Sharira)
The karmic matter that covers the soul is called karmic body. It changes
every moment because new karma is continuously attached to the soul due
to activities of body, mind, and speech. At the time of death, the soul
is accompanied by this body for the next birth. It leaves the present
physical (Audaric) body behind. The karmic body along with tejas body
forms the basis of the other newly produced audaric body. It also
provides the fruits of living being's past action when due.
- Aharac body - This body is possessed
by some special souls. Aharac body is very small in size. These souls
put on this body to travel far distant places. Sometimes monks who
possess this body can travel to the other part of the universe (ex.
Mahavideha Kshetra) to visit a Tirthankara to remove their doubts about
soul, karma etc.
It is said that Achaurya Shri Kunda
Kunda possessed Aharac body. With this body he visited Shri Srimandhar
Swami, the present Tirthankara of the Mahavideha Kshetra. He removed his
doubt about soul and matter substances.
- Vaikriya body - This body can be
obtained by human being by practicing yoga, meditation, etc. With this
body one can transform his body into a very small or a large size. The
heavenly beings and hellish beings possess this body by birth.
All worldly souls possess three bodies (Audaric,
Tejas, and Karmic) and some unique soul may possess additional one or two
bodies.
